Output dac6aac0ab8308d7a571e499c56f5fb08c4ac9280a453d289c9858e089471422:0

value
43493
script pubkey
OP_0 OP_PUSHBYTES_20 c5a37e08e5dd7d36d9a1d255185cd62800a01d21
address
bc1qck3huz89m47ndkdp6f23shxk9qq2q8fpq48j6u
transaction
dac6aac0ab8308d7a571e499c56f5fb08c4ac9280a453d289c9858e089471422
confirmations
40574
spent
true